The truth is that: - hdd are too slow for ceph, the first time you need to do a rebalance or similar you will discover... - if you want to use hdds do a raid with your controller and use the controller BBU cache (do not consider controllers with hdd cache), and present the raid as one ceph disk. - enabling single hdd write cache (that is not battery protected) is far worse than enabling controller cache (which I assume is always protected by BBU) - anyway the best thing for ceph is to use nvme disks. We are testing an experimental Ceph cluster with server and controller at subject.
The controller have not an HBA mode, but only a 'NonRAID' mode, come sort of 'auto RAID0' configuration.
We are using SSD SATA disks (MICRON MTFDDAK480TDT) that perform very well, and SAS HDD disks (SEAGATE ST8000NM014A) that instead perform very bad (particulary, very low IOPS).
There's some hint for disk/controller configuration/optimization?
